Rob Halford To Guest On The Simpsons

Judas Priest frontman Rob Halford will appear in an upcoming episode of The Simpsons, singing a parody of classic track Breaking The Law.

The metal god lends his voice to a storyline in which Homer Simpson learns how to illegally download movies and holds screening sessions for neighbours – leading to an FBI chase drama.

Executive producer Matt Selman says: “Even though Homer is stealing he’s doing it for the community.”

Halford, whose band is nearing completion of their first album with new guitarist Richie Faulkner, recently said: “I never say no to anything. If you do, you don’t know what you’ve missed. If it doesn’t work out then at least you can say you’ve tried it; there’s nothing words than having regrets.”

Judas Priest hired Faulkner after KK Downing decided to leave the band in 2011. He recently explained he felt they’d run out of creativity – but denied reports he’d retired.
